Product Parameter Table
| Parameter | Value |
|---|
| Enclosure Material | Fiberglass (Matte Black) |
| Frequency Range | 5725~5850 MHz |
| Bandwidth | 125 MHz |
| Gain | 12±0.5 dBi |
| Polarization | Vertical |
| Half-Power Beam Width | H-plane: 360° E-plane: 8° |
| Input Impedance | Ω: 50 VSWR: ≥1.5 |
| Power Capacity | 100 kW |
| Connector Type | N-J |
| Dimensions | Φ32*600 mm |
| Weight | Kg: 0.73 kg |
| Operating Temperature | -40~75 °C |
